I'm no expert but I am doing exactly this at the moment. I have done it with an Android ioio board and mosfets and now I am doing it with a PIC18F14k22. It has 5 hardware pwm outputs. I used ttl level mosfets driven directly and they can carry a couple of amps. The resistors need heat sinking though but it was easy. I also purchased a 5m RGB LED strip off ebay. It comes with a controller. I piggy backed onto that and that is capable of driving about an amp per channel.
